The Mental Capacity Act 2005 is a crucial piece of legislation that protects the rights and interests of individuals who may lack the mental capacity to make decisions for themselves. It provides a legal framework for making decisions on behalf of those who are unable to do so.
The Mental Capacity Act 2005 sets out key principles and guidelines for assessing a person's capacity to make decisions. It also outlines the process for making decisions in the best interests of individuals who lack capacity.
Some of the key components of the Mental Capacity Act 2005 include the presumption of capacity, the importance of supporting individuals to make their own decisions, and the role of independent mental capacity advocates.
